. The first single titled "Kabzaa Title Track" was released on 4 February 2023. The second single titled "Namaami Namaami" was released on 16 February 2023. The third single titled "Chum Chum Chali Chali" was released on 26 February 2023.

The motion poster of the film was released on the birthday of Upendra on 18 September 2021. The film's teaser was released in September 2022.

Reception


Box office

The film was reported to have collected on its opening day domestically though the makers claimed the first day worldwide gross collections to be ₹25 crores. The first weekend gross was reported to be ₹20.60 crores. The 5 day collection was reported to be ₹27.19 crores. At the end of 8 days, the collections were reported to be ₹30 - ₹31 crore. The film grossed 34.5 crore in 11 days against a budget of ₹120 crore and became a box office bomb.
